Types of French Driving Licenses
The French driving license system consists of a number of classifications, including:
Category B: This is the standard license for driving vehicles and light automobiles.Classification A: This is for motorbikes.Category C: This is for driving heavy products automobiles.Category D: This one is for buses and larger guest cars.
In France, each classification comes with its own set of requirements, paperwork, and evaluations. Most individuals intending to drive an automobile will concentrate on Category B.

1. Can I drive in France with an American or other foreign license?Yes, as a traveler or momentary local, you can utilize your valid foreign driving license, however if you become a long-lasting resident, you'll require to exchange or acquire a French driving license.

2. The length of time does it take to get a French driving license?Depending on the person's familiarity with driving and the selected driving school, the procedure can take a few months to a year.

3. What documents do I need to apply for a French driving license?Usually, you will require recognition, proof of residency, medical certificates, and any specific documents requested by the driving school or licensing authority.

4. Is there an age limit for getting a French driving license?Yes, you need to be at least 18 years of ages to obtain a standard driving license in France.
